"Shadow Seeker" by Peter Blackwell, original oil on canvas
Kenyan born, Peter Blackwell has been intrigued by Africa's environments and its exceptional diversity all his life. Raised on a remote farm in Northern Kenya, the African bush was Peter's outdoor arena for entertainment and learning. Peter spends many weeks of the year in the bush, where he not only obtains the reference material necessary to create his works, but also to study his subjects. His painting style, though realistic, also suggests an unconventional flavor as he constantly strives to create original works that are anatomically accurate, yet at the same time are fresh and innovative. Each of Peter's works is an attempt to capture even brief moments of Africa's beauty, and it is his wish that each piece may offer unique insights into the Africa he knows. "Gin and Tonic Trees" oil on canvas by Brent Dodd
Landscape Artist, Brent Dodd was born in 1978 in the southern district of Zimbabwe. Early on in his life his family moved onto a farm in the Eastern Highlands. He attended one of Zimbabwe’s premier boarding schools for boys, Peterhouse Boys, before studying Art at Rhodes University in South Africa. He has travelled extensively in Southern and Central Africa, committing his thoughts and findings to canvas. His work describes that childhood of growing up in an African country where one finds adventure and fascination around every corner. From steam locomotives of the Zimbabwean stockyards to the open fields of his family’s tobacco farm; African landscapes from the Zambezi River to the source of the Nile, moments are caught and depicted in various mediums, including both Oil paint and Pencil work. Brent now paints and works in the KwaZulu-Natal Province of South Africa. Biographies accompanying paintings document excerpts from his novel Finding Home, which is still to be published. "Great Rams of Mongolia" bronze sculpture by Rick Taylor
Bronze Sculpture "Great Rams of Mongolia" #1 of a limited edition of 48. This sculpture is a 1/5 scale model based on the world record Gobi argali taken by long time DSC member, Trevor Ahlberg, in 2009 in Mongolia. Wild sheep are a favorite subject of Rick's as he is also a sheep hunter. He made a monument of a High Altai argali and it was installed in downtown UlaanBataar in 2006. This bronze "Great Rams of Mongolia" will be available to be customized to replicate any Mongolian argali that you want.
